Is Ham a Processed Food?
Yes, ham is definitely a processed food. It undergoes various treatments like curing, smoking, and salting to preserve it and enhance its flavor, making it fall under the processed food category.

Understanding the Processing of Ham: From Pig to Plate
Ham starts as a cut of pork, typically from the hind leg of a pig. However, the journey from raw pork to the recognizable cured meat we know involves several key steps that firmly classify it as a processed food.
- Curing: This process involves treating the pork with a combination of salt, nitrates or nitrites, sugar, and other spices. Curing serves multiple purposes: preserving the meat, inhibiting bacterial growth (particularly Clostridium botulinum, which causes botulism), and enhancing the flavor and color.
- Smoking (Optional): Many hams are then smoked over wood chips (e.g., hickory, applewood) to further enhance their flavor and preservation. Smoking imparts a characteristic smoky taste and aroma.
- Cooking: The ham is cooked to a safe internal temperature, ensuring the destruction of harmful bacteria. This can be done through various methods like baking, boiling, or steaming.
- Packaging: Finally, the ham is packaged and labeled, ready for distribution and consumption.
The Nutritional Landscape of Ham: Benefits and Considerations
Ham offers certain nutritional benefits. It’s a good source of protein, essential for building and repairing tissues. It also contains vitamins and minerals, including iron, zinc, and B vitamins. However, the processing involved in making ham inevitably impacts its nutritional profile.
Nutrient | Amount (per 100g serving of cooked ham) |
---|---|
Calories | ~145 |
Protein | ~20g |
Fat | ~7g |
Sodium | ~1000mg |
Iron | ~5% DV |
The high sodium content is a significant concern. The curing process relies heavily on salt, contributing to ham’s characteristically salty taste and significantly elevated sodium levels. Excess sodium intake is linked to increased blood pressure and cardiovascular disease. Additionally, the presence of nitrates and nitrites, while crucial for preservation, has been linked to potential health risks, although this is a complex and debated topic.
Distinguishing Ham Types: Processing Levels Vary
Not all hams are created equal. Different types of ham undergo varying levels of processing, which impacts their flavor, texture, and nutritional content. Some common types include:
- Fresh Ham: This is uncured pork leg; it is not technically “ham” in the cured sense and must be cooked thoroughly like any other raw pork cut.
- Cured, Uncooked Ham: This ham has been cured but requires cooking before consumption.
- Cured and Cooked Ham: This ham has been cured and cooked, making it ready to eat.
- Dry-Cured Ham: This ham is cured using a dry salt mixture and air-dried for an extended period. Examples include prosciutto and Serrano ham. They are often less processed than wet-cured hams.
- Water-Added Ham: This type of ham has water added during the curing process to increase its weight and juiciness. However, it may also result in a less intense flavor.
Common Misconceptions about Ham: Separating Fact from Fiction
Many misconceptions surround ham, particularly regarding its safety and health effects. It’s essential to address these to provide a clear understanding of this popular food.
One common misconception is that all nitrates/nitrites are harmful. While concerns exist, naturally occurring nitrates in vegetables are generally considered beneficial. The debate primarily revolves around added nitrates/nitrites in processed meats and their potential conversion to nitrosamines during cooking. Another misconception is that ham is inherently unhealthy. While high in sodium, it can be enjoyed in moderation as part of a balanced diet. The key is awareness of portion sizes and sodium content.
Frequently Asked Questions (FAQs) about Ham and Processed Foods
Is all processed food bad for you?
No, not all processed food is inherently bad. Processing encompasses a wide range of techniques, from simple freezing to complex chemical alterations. Minimal processing, such as freezing fruits and vegetables to preserve them, can even enhance nutritional value. The key lies in understanding the level of processing and the ingredients used. Highly processed foods, often containing high levels of sodium, sugar, and unhealthy fats, should be consumed in moderation.
What are the potential health risks associated with eating ham?
The primary health risks associated with eating ham stem from its high sodium content and the presence of nitrates and nitrites. High sodium intake can lead to increased blood pressure and cardiovascular disease. Nitrates and nitrites, while essential for preservation, can potentially convert to nitrosamines during cooking, which have been linked to an increased risk of certain cancers. However, the risk is often overstated, and consuming a balanced diet rich in antioxidants can help mitigate these effects.
How can I choose healthier ham options?
When choosing ham, opt for varieties labeled as “lower sodium” or “no nitrates/nitrites added.” Look for hams that are minimally processed and made with natural ingredients. Reading the nutrition label carefully is crucial to compare sodium levels and other nutritional information. Consider choosing smaller portions to control sodium intake.
What are nitrates and nitrites, and why are they added to ham?
Nitrates and nitrites are chemical compounds used in the curing process of ham. They serve several important functions: inhibiting the growth of harmful bacteria (especially Clostridium botulinum), preserving the meat’s color, and contributing to the characteristic flavor of cured meats. Without these compounds, ham would be more susceptible to spoilage and pose a greater risk of foodborne illness.
Are there any nitrate-free or nitrite-free hams available?
Yes, some manufacturers produce hams labeled as “nitrate-free” or “no nitrates/nitrites added.” However, these products typically use natural sources of nitrates/nitrites, such as celery powder or beet juice, which are naturally high in these compounds. These are still technically sources of nitrates and nitrites, but they are derived from natural sources.
How does smoking affect the healthiness of ham?
Smoking ham can add flavor and aroma but also introduces potentially harmful compounds called polycyclic aromatic hydrocarbons (PAHs). PAHs are formed during the burning of wood and can deposit on the surface of the ham. Choosing naturally smoked hams, using different wood chips for the smoking process, and removing the skin before eating can reduce exposure to PAHs.
Is dry-cured ham healthier than wet-cured ham?
Generally, dry-cured ham (like prosciutto) is often considered a healthier option than wet-cured ham. Dry-curing typically involves less processing and fewer additives than wet-curing. However, both types are still high in sodium. It’s important to read labels and compare nutritional information regardless of the curing method.
Can I safely cook ham at home?
Yes, you can safely cook ham at home. Ensure the ham reaches a safe internal temperature to kill any potential bacteria. Use a meat thermometer to monitor the temperature. Follow recommended cooking times and temperatures based on the type of ham you’re preparing.
How long can I safely store ham in the refrigerator?
Cooked ham can typically be stored in the refrigerator for 3 to 5 days. Unopened, commercially packaged ham can last for several weeks, but always check the expiration date on the package. Proper storage is crucial to prevent bacterial growth and foodborne illness.
Can I freeze ham?
Yes, ham can be frozen to extend its shelf life. Wrap the ham tightly in freezer-safe packaging or place it in a freezer bag. Frozen ham can last for 1 to 2 months without significant loss of quality. Thaw frozen ham in the refrigerator before cooking or consuming.
Does cooking method affect the sodium content of ham?
No, the cooking method does not significantly affect the sodium content of ham. The sodium is primarily introduced during the curing process. While some minor leaching may occur during boiling, it’s not a substantial amount. Focus on choosing lower-sodium ham to begin with.
